Transaction 32704323140b16e84141fb9dafa4244ed83066ff70287eeee5177aec04ff58ac
1 Input
1 Output
-
32704323140b16e84141fb9dafa4244ed83066ff70287eeee5177aec04ff58ac:0
- value
- 554561
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d8c34635d176782148c422d5d3250d04b57859e
- address
- bc1qrkxrgc6azancy9yvggk46vjs6p940pv7lsvs75